From: Intracellular pH regulation: characterization and functional investigation of H+ transporters in Stylophora pistillata

Fig. 2

a Exon/intron organization of V0 V-ATPase subunit a in the genome of S. pistillata. Exons are represented as boxes, whereas introns are depicted as lines. b Sequence comparison of S. pistillata and H. sapiens V0 V-ATPase subunit a. Identical and similar amino acids (aa) are shaded in black and grey, respectively. The boxes represent the predicted transmembrane segments in H. sapiens V0 V-ATPase subunit a. The circles and crosses represent phosphorylation and N-glycosylation sites, respectively, in spiHvCN1.1 and spiHvCN1.2. The asterisk indicates a conserved R relevant to H+ transport
